V & A Exhibition The Cult of Beauty opens Saturday 2 April

The Cult of Beauty: The Aesthetic Movement 1860-1900

2 April - 17 July 2011

Book Tickets

The Cult of Beauty: The Aesthetic 
Movement 1860-1900
This is the first major exhibition to comprehensively explore Aestheticism, an extraordinary artistic movement which sought to escape the ugliness and materialism of the Victorian era by creating a new kind of art and beauty. It shows how Aesthetic artists, designers, poets and collectors promoted the idea of 'art for art's sake' and how the idea of the 'house beautiful' became a touchstone of cultured life.
Organised with the Fine Arts Museum of San Francisco in collaboration with the Musée d'Orsay, Paris
